For the past 15 years the Center for Biblical Hebrew has been involved in teaching Hebrew to all who were interested regardless of religious or theological views. During these years we observed a tremendous increased interest in the Hebrew language and the original Hebrew text of the Bible.
Newly formed communities and Bible study groups also showed a keen interest in the Hebrew language. Many were seeking a deeper understanding of the Biblical text that can be attained only by incorporating a knowledge of the original Hebrew.
Historically, our founding fathers knew Hebrew. It was one of the languages competing for the privilege of being the official language spoken in America. I feel that introducing the Hebrew language to America is an idea whose time has come, at least among those who love the Bible and its values.

The Goal of the Program
To create a national network of Hebrew speakers with a keen interest in the Bible and the nation of Israel.
To have interested individuals, groups, and communities reading, writing, and conversing with each other in basic Hebrew, within one year.
What Will the Program be Like?
This program will:
Organize and serve, under one umbrella, the new movement of people who are interested in the text of the Bible in its original Hebrew form.
Provide unified professionally supervised and knowledgeable teaching from a native speaker's perspective.
Help you aquire useful basic Hebrew conversation skills based on Biblical vocabulary.
Teach you Biblical words and phrases that you can use in everyday conversation among your friends and between groups. Learn to greet each other and use Biblical phrases in your newly acquired Hebrew conversation!
Use the synergy of a national group to encourage you, the individual, to "stick with it" and to accomplish your goal together.
Help you learn to read and write the Hebrew letters, use the Hebrew vowel system to read, and introduce you to basic Hebrew grammar.
Enable you to read actual Hebrew text from the Bible.
Give you the tools you need to enhance Bible study and delve into unimaginable depths of understanding.
